A concussion is: "defined as a complex pathophysiological process affecting the brain, induced by traumatic biomechanical forces." (Cantu et al., 2005) Let's break it down: Concussions can be caused by a direct blow to the head, face, neck, or anywhere else on the body where the force of the blow is transferred to the head. Children with dizziness at the time of concussion have 6 times the risk of developing PCS, and dizziness is the second most common symptom of PCS in pediatric patients. Step 2: Have the athlete evaluated by on-site medical personnel (may include athletic trainer, EMT, physician) and/or emergency room physician if needed.
